A custom packaging box mockup is the physical or digital prototype that bridges CAD design and production tooling. In modern e-commerce packaging programs, mockups prevent the two most expensive failure modes: dimensional misfit in the fulfillment line and structural collapse in the last-mile distribution environment. This guide covers how engineers specify, build, and validate mockups before committing steel-rule dies or digital cutting files to production.

Mockup Types: Digital, Quick-Turn, and Pre-Production

A complete validation workflow uses three mockup tiers:

  1. Digital 3D mockup. Built from a CAD dieline in ArtiosCAD, Engview, or Illustrator with Esko Studio. Renders simulate print finishes (soft-touch, foil, spot UV) but cannot verify board crush behavior or glue-flap tolerance.
  2. Quick-turn structural prototype. Cut on flatbed or digital die-cutters (Zünd, Esko Kongsberg) from the actual stock — E-flute (1.5 mm), B-flute (3.0 mm), or C-flute (4.0 mm) — with correct ECT and caliper. Turnaround: 2–5 business days.
  3. Pre-production mockup. Produced on the actual cutting die with the production printing plates. This is the only mockup valid for line-speed trials and automated case-erector testing.

Skipping tier 2 is the most common sourcing error: artwork approved on a digital render hides a 0.5 mm caliper mismatch that jams high-speed cartoners later.

Structural Specifications to Verify in the Mockup

Treat the mockup as a spec sheet in physical form. Verify:

  • Board grade. Mailer boxes typically use 200–275 g/m² liner with E-flute; shipper boxes use B or C-flute at 32–44 ECT. Compare grades in our black shipping box spec guide.
  • Compression margin. Stack load at 5-high pallet storage should not exceed 60% of the box’s estimated dynamic compression strength.
  • Tolerance stack. Slot and slit cut tolerances of ±0.5 mm; glue-flap overlap minimum 12 mm for reliable hot-melt or cold-glue bonding.
  • Drop orientation. The mockup’s closure geometry determines which faces survive edge drops — a key driver in RSC vs. mailer vs. tray-and-lid selection.

Mockup vs. Production Validation Matrix

Validation Stage Cost Range Verifies
Digital 3D render $0–150 Artwork, dieline geometry
Digital-cut prototype $50–400 Fit, caliper, assembly
Pre-production run $300–1,500 Line speed, glue, print color

Print Proofing on Mockups

Color on corrugated behaves differently than on SBS board: direct flexo on kraft shifts Pantone values by ΔE 3–6 versus coated litho labels. Litho-laminated mockups (0.3 mm C1S mounted to E-flute) reproduce brand color within ΔE ≤ 2 and are the correct substrate for retail-facing SKUs. Always proof on the production board — proofing on coated paper stock invalidates color sign-off.

Transit Testing: Where Mockups Earn Their Cost

A mockup that assembles well can still fail distribution. Feed finished mockups into a laboratory transit sequence per ASTM D4169 Transit Testing Standards, which defines assured-performance distribution cycles including randomized vibration (PSD profiles) and 10-condition drop schedules. Paired with ISTA 3A for parcel networks, this testing quantifies whether your flute selection and corner geometry survive real carrier handling. Budget $800–$2,500 for an ISTA 3A run — trivial compared to a single recall-driven restock cycle.

With extended producer responsibility (EPR) fees now active across most U.S. states and PPWR recyclability rules phasing in through 2026 in the EU, validate material choices early: mono-material corrugated mockups consistently outscore laminated structures on recyclability scoring and lower per-kg EPR fees.

Sourcing Workflow Checklist

  1. Finalize the CAD dieline with inner dimensions from the product plus cushioning (min. 3 mm clearance per face for rigid goods).
  2. Order a digital-cut prototype on production board grade.
  3. Run drop and compression spot-checks or a full D4169 cycle for e-commerce SKUs.
  4. Approve a pre-production mockup with production plates and dies.
  5. Release tooling only after line-speed trial at ≥85% of target erector speed.

Frequently Asked Questions

How much does a custom packaging box mockup cost?
Digital-cut structural prototypes typically run $50–$400 per unit depending on board grade and finishing; digital 3D renders are often free with a dieline order.

Can I skip the physical mockup if I have a 3D render?
No. Renders cannot verify board caliper, crush strength, glue-flap bonding, or erector line performance — always produce at least one production-board prototype.

What testing should a mailer box mockup pass?
For parcel e-commerce, target ISTA 3A or an ASTM D4169 Distribution Cycle 13 sequence, plus a compression test at 60% safety margin for pallet stacking.
